Overview Tobraject 0.3% Eye Drop

This antibiotic eye drop solution, Tobraject 0.3%, effectively combats bacterial infections affecting the eyes (such as conjunctivitis) and eyelids (like blepharitis). It also serves as a prophylactic measure against infection post-eye injury or surgery. By inhibiting bacterial proliferation, Tobraject 0.3% facilitates infection resolution. Adhere strictly to your ophthalmologist's administration guidelines. Allow at least five minutes between applications of different eye medications. Maintain consistent, evenly spaced dosing intervals as directed. Complete the prescribed treatment regimen; premature cessation might result in recurrence or exacerbation of the infection. Tobraject 0.3% is ineffective against non-bacterial (e.g., viral) eye infections and should only be used under professional medical guidance. Overuse of antibiotics diminishes their future efficacy. Minor, temporary side effects, including stinging, burning, itching, and redness, may occur. Report persistent or worsening symptoms to your doctor. Transient blurred vision is possible immediately after application; avoid driving until this subsides. Refrain from wearing contact lenses during treatment and while the eye infection persists.

How Tobraject 0.3% Eye Drop works:

Tobramycin ophthalmic solution 0.3% is a bacterial growth inhibitor. It functions by disrupting the production of vital bacterial proteins, thus halting infection in the eye. This effectively manages your ocular infection.

FAQs on Tobraject 0.3% Eye Drop

Tobraject 0.3% Eye Drops effectively treat many bacterial eye infections. However, its use is limited to infections caused by susceptible bacteria. These include *S. aureus*, *S. epidermidis*, certain Streptococci, *Pseudomonas aeruginosa*, *Escherichia coli*, *Klebsiella pneumoniae*, *Enterobacter aerogenes*, *Proteus mirabilis*, *Morganella morganii*, most *Proteus vulgaris*, *Haemophilus influenzae*, *H. aegyptius*, *Moraxella lacunata*, *Acinetobacter calcoaceticus*, and some *Neisseria* species. Your doctor will determine if this medication is appropriate for your specific infection.
Treatment length depends on infection severity. Mild to moderate infections might require 1-2 eye drops four times daily, while severe infections may need 2 drops hourly. Always follow your doctor's instructions precisely regarding dosage and frequency; never deviate from the prescribed regimen.
Wash your hands before applying eye drops. Keep the dropper tip from contacting your eye or other surfaces. Tilt your head back, and instill one drop into your eye. Keep your head down, eyes closed, and avoid blinking or squinting for 2-3 minutes. Gently press on the inner corner of your eye for 1 minute to prevent drainage. Allow 5 minutes between drops if using more than one. Wait at least 10 minutes before using other prescribed eye drops.
Contact your doctor if your symptoms worsen during treatment or persist after completing the full course.
Don't discontinue Tobraject 0.3% Eye Drops without your doctor's advice, even if you feel better. Symptom improvement doesn't guarantee complete infection clearance. Continue using the drops as directed to ensure full treatment.
